Gradual proximity touch screen

1. An apparatus, comprising:

  • a touch screen display;

    a sensing mechanism operable to sense an associated object spaced a distance from the touch screen display; and

    ,control logic operatively coupled with the sensing mechanism and the touch screen display;

    wherein the control logic is operable to calculate an anticipated touch point for the associated object on the touch screen; and

    ,wherein the control logic is responsive to calculating the anticipated touch point to gradually discover the associated object by scaling a size of a portion of the touch screen display around the anticipated touch point in accordance with the distance, wherein the portion of the touch screen display that is scaled is scaled in accordance with a size of the associated object wherein a relative larger area is scaled in accordance with the associated object being a finger of an associated user of the apparatus and a relative smaller area is scaled in accordance with the associated object being a stylus pointing device.
